Scottish giants Celtic have been drawn against Norwegian outfit Bodo/Glimt in the Europa Conference League playoff round.

After finishing third in the Europa League group stage, the Hoops continue their European journey by dropping into UEFA's inaugural third-tier competition.

Heading into Monday's draw, Celtic faced the prospect of being drawn against one of eight teams who finished second in their Europa Conference League group, with victory in the playoff round rewarded with a place in the last 16.

Ange Postecoglou's men avoided a potential tie with either Tottenham Hotspur or Vitesse, instead being drawn against Eliteserien holders Bodo/Glimt, who finished second in Group C behind Roma and remain unbeaten in Europe this term.

The two clubs have never locked horns in a competitive fixture, though the Hoops are familiar with Norwegian opposition, having previously faced Rosenborg on 12 occasions and winning seven in the process.

Celtic will host the first leg at Parkhead on February 17, before Bodo/Glimt welcome the Hoops to Aspmyra Stadion for the second leg on February 24.

Elsewhere, former Celtic boss Brendan Rodgers will prepare his Leicester City side for a two-legged tie against Randers, while Tottenham or Vitesse have been drawn against Rapid Vienna.

Draw in full:

Marseille vs. Qarabag FK
PSV Eindhoven vs. Maccabi Tel Aviv
Fenerbahce vs. Slavia Prague
FC Midtjylland vs. PAOK
Leicester City vs. Randers
Celtic vs. Bodo/Glimt
Sparta Prague vs. Partizan
Rapid Vienna vs. Vitesse/Tottenham
